Project Type Typical Range
Vinyl Siding $3,000 - $7,000
Fiber Cement Siding $8,000 - $15,000
Wood Siding $5,000 - $12,000
Aluminum Siding $4,000 - $9,000
Engineered Wood Siding $6,000 - $13,000
Insulated Siding $8,000 - $16,000

Key Cost Influences

Residential siding installation in Ann Arbor, MI, involves upgrading or replacing exterior wall coverings to improve durability and curb appeal.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help homeowners plan their projects effectively. This overview provides an outline of common factors involved in residential siding installation, including material choices, project scope, labor considerations, permitting, and additional options.

  • Materials: Common siding options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and aluminum, each offering different aesthetics and durability suited to Ann Arbor’s climate.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small sections to full-home replacements, depending on the size of the residence and desired coverage.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ity varies based on home design, existing structure, and chosen siding material, influencing installation time and techniques.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Ann Arbor may require permits for siding replacement, especially for larger projects or structural modifications.
  • Additional Options: Extras such as insulation, trim, and weather barriers can be included to enhance performance and appearance.

Project Size &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story home (up to 1,500 sq ft) $5,000 - $12,000
Two-story home (1,500 - 2,500 sq ft) $10,000 - $20,000
Large residential building (over 2,500 sq ft) $20,000 - $40,000
Partial siding replacement (e.g., one side of the house) $2,500 - $7,500

In Ann Arbor, MI, project costs for residential siding installation can vary based on the home's size, siding material, and complexity of the project.
